Which of the following is not an aromatic compound?

1
Cyclopropene
2
Furan
3
Aniline
4
Thiophene

Explanation

Cyclopropene is not an aromatic compound, and here's why: 1. Cyclopropene (Option 1): Aromatic compounds must satisfy Huckel's rule, which states that a molecule must have a planar ring of continuously overlapping p-orbitals and contain (4n + 2) ╧А electrons, where n is a non-negative integer.
